RE: Picture of 3 out of 4
« Reply #3 on: October 29, 2008, 05:39:24 AM »
One , I grew tired of the extra carry weight , Although the stocks did balance perfectly when shooting offhand or from a rest. But were heavy carring around the range in my gun carrier . Also, after the big deal made about Scott Thome EV2 in a custom stock winning the Nationals in hunter class , I decided I didn't want to be part of that controversy . And, I got almost enough cash out of the sales to start building me a storage building in my backyard to store my bicycles in . I may down the road get Brian to build me another custom stock , but it'll be a sporter style , not a target model. kirby
